為使 貴審查委員對本創作之目的、特徵及功效能夠有更進一步之瞭解與認識,茲配合實施方式及圖式詳述如後:參閱第一至第七圖所示,本創作提供一種自行車把手結構,係包含有:一自行車把手套10,包括硬質的一內管體20,前述硬質的內管體20外周固設軟質的一外套體30,而內管體20並得套組至硬質的自行車把手管90外周,主要係為一內迫鎖組件40,包括內管體20末端往內突設一錐形塊21,內管體20末端貫穿錐形塊21設一漸小錐形孔22,一C形束環50,前述C形束環50設兩對應第一、二內錐孔51、52相互導通,往側面導通設一剖槽53,第一內錐孔51套於錐形塊21,一斜面迫緊件60,包括設一斜錐面61,前述斜錐面61套組於第二內錐孔52,一螺母70抵於斜面迫緊件60平面端62,一調整螺絲80穿貫漸小錐形孔22、C形束環50、斜面迫緊件60之一通孔63後螺鎖前述螺母70,C形束環50外周接近自行車把手管90內孔徑91,所以在旋鎖調整螺絲80迫使螺母70抵推斜面迫緊件60強迫C形束環50擴張時,得以迫緊C形束環50緊固於自行車把手管90內,進而固定自行車把手套10於自行車把手管90者。In order to enable your review committee to have a better understanding and understanding of the purpose, characteristics and efficacy of this creation, please refer to the implementation method and the drawings as follows: See the first to seventh figures, this creation provides a bicycle handle The structure comprises: a bicycle handle glove 10, comprising a rigid inner tube body 20, the outer end of the rigid inner tube body 20 is fixed with a soft outer sleeve body 30, and the inner tube body 20 is set to be rigid. The outer circumference of the bicycle handle tube 90 is mainly an inner forced lock assembly 40, and a tapered block 21 is protruded inwardly from the end of the inner tubular body 20. The end of the inner tubular body 20 is provided with a tapered tapered hole 22 through the tapered block 21. a C-shaped collar 50, the C-shaped collar 50 is provided with two corresponding first and second inner tapered holes 51, 52 which are electrically connected to each other, and a split groove 53 is formed on the side, and the first inner tapered hole 51 is sleeved on the tapered block. 21, a beveling pressing member 60, comprising a tapered surface 61, the tapered tapered surface 61 is sleeved in the second inner tapered hole 52, a nut 70 is abutted against the flat end 62 of the inclined pressing member 60, an adjusting screw 80 Through the through tapered hole 22, the C-shaped collar 50, and the through hole 63 of the inclined pressing member 60, the nut 70 is screwed, and the C shape is formed. The outer circumference of the ring 50 is close to the inner diameter 91 of the bicycle handle tube 90, so when the twist lock adjusting screw 80 forces the nut 70 against the push surface pressing member 60 to force the C-shaped collar 50 to expand, the C-shaped collar 50 is tightened and fastened to the bicycle. Inside the handle tube 90, the bicycle handle 10 is fixed to the bicycle handle tube 90.

所述之自行車把手結構,其中前述斜面迫緊件60平面端62凹設一六角孔64,前述六角孔64供組入前述 螺母70,據以限制螺母70不會跟隨前述調整螺絲80旋轉。The bicycle handle structure, wherein the flat end 62 of the inclined surface pressing member 60 is recessed with a hexagonal hole 64 for assembling the aforementioned hexagonal hole 64 The nut 70, according to the restriction nut 70, does not rotate following the aforementioned adjustment screw 80.

所述之自行車把手結構,其中前述錐形塊21外周設有一平面211,第一內錐孔51內設有一平面511與之貼合,使前述調整螺絲80旋轉時,C形束環50不會跟隨旋轉。The bicycle handle structure has a flat surface 211 on the outer circumference of the tapered block 21, and a flat surface 511 is disposed in the first inner tapered hole 51, so that the C-shaped collar 50 does not rotate when the adjusting screw 80 rotates. Follow the rotation.

所述之自行車把手結構,其中前述C形束環50第二內錐孔52內設有一平面521,斜面迫緊件60之斜錐面61上設有一平面611與之貼合,使前述調整螺絲80旋轉時,斜面迫緊件60不會跟隨旋轉。The bicycle handle structure, wherein the second inner tapered hole 52 of the C-shaped collar 50 is provided with a flat surface 521, and the inclined tapered surface 61 of the inclined pressing member 60 is provided with a flat surface 611 to be attached thereto, so that the adjusting screw is provided. When the 80 is rotated, the ramp pressing member 60 does not follow the rotation.

配合參閱第二、七圖所示,其自行車把手套10套入自行車把手管90外周,並使內迫鎖組件40進入至自行車把手管90內孔92中後,得以如第二圖一般取用一支六角扳手93,套接調整螺絲80並開始旋轉,調整螺絲80旋轉的過程中C形束環50、斜面迫緊件60與螺母70都不會跟隨旋轉,使得螺母70產生朝向調整螺絲80方向進給的推力,螺母70的推力得以推動斜面迫緊件60斜錐面61抵推C形束環50第二內錐孔52,錐形塊21抵其第一內錐孔51而迫使C形束環50只能外周擴張,進而迫緊於自行車把手管90內孔92,而得以固定自行車把手套10與自行車把手管90者。Referring to the second and seventh figures, the bicycle glove 10 is placed on the outer circumference of the bicycle handle tube 90, and the inner lock assembly 40 is inserted into the inner hole 92 of the bicycle handle tube 90, and is taken as shown in the second figure. A hex wrench 93 is sleeved and adjusted to rotate 80. During the rotation of the adjusting screw 80, the C-shaped collar 50, the inclined pressing member 60 and the nut 70 do not follow the rotation, so that the nut 70 is oriented toward the adjusting screw 80. The thrust of the direction feed, the thrust of the nut 70 pushes the inclined surface of the beveling member 60 to push the second inner tapered hole 52 of the C-shaped collar 50, and the tapered block 21 abuts against the first inner tapered hole 51 forcing C The collar ring 50 can only be expanded peripherally, thereby tightening the inner hole 92 of the bicycle handle tube 90 to secure the bicycle handle 10 and the bicycle handle tube 90.
